The Internal Medicine Physician examines patients, records medical histories, and orders diagnostic tests to assess health conditions. They diagnose diseases, prescribe treatments and medications, and provide preventive health advice. The role also involves inoculating patients and referring them to specialists as needed, requiring a valid medical license and DEA certification.
